#7dabb3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7dabb3 is composed of 49% red, 67.1%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.2% cyan, 4.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 188.9 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 59.6%. #7dabb3 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#005767.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#7dabb3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7dabb3 has RGB values of R:125, G:171,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 8235955.

Hex triplet 7dabb3 #7dabb3
RGB Decimal 125, 171, 179 rgb(125,171,179)
RGB Percent 49, 67.1, 70.2 rgb(49%,67.1%,70.2%)
CMYK 30, 4, 0, 30
HSL 188.9°, 26.2, 59.6 hsl(188.9,26.2%,59.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 188.9°, 30.2, 70.2
Web Safe 6699cc #6699cc
CIE-LAB 67.081, -13.361, -9.072
XYZ 31.155, 36.739, 48.095
xyY 0.269, 0.317, 36.739
CIE-LCH 67.081, 16.15, 214.177
CIE-LUV 67.081, -22.945, -11.531
Hunter-Lab 60.613, -14.324, -4.616
Binary 01111101, 10101011, 10110011

Shades and Tints of #7dabb3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040606 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fb is the lightest one.
